The academy that was supposed to make me strong is collapsing.
Not metaphorically. Spirit Peak is sinking—one hundred feet already—and the elders would rather execute the messenger than admit their “immortal” foundation is failing.
I’m Wei Luo: a disgraced heir with a broken body, a cursed “Rot” in my chest, and an engineer’s brain that refuses to accept magic as an excuse.
When I expose the truth, the Arbiter gives me a choice:
Fix the descent… or be unmade.
My solution is simple in theory: the Spirit Nexus—the engine keeping the floating peaks aloft—is misfiring. I can’t repair the realm’s Pillars, but I can install a regulator, re-pressurize the system, and buy time before the whole academy breaks apart mid-air.
There’s just one problem.
Elder Feng is already in the Nexus Chamber… and he’s turning the heart of the mountain into a weapon.
The tunnels beneath the Nexus run hot with violet corruption. Disciples become glitching, physics-scrambled monsters. And when the invasion hits, Void-Centurions start harvesting entire peaks like crops.
To stop the collapse, I’ll need more than cultivation.
I’ll need control.
With Mei’s grounding, Yue Ying’s resonance, and Yan Ling’s cold-blooded precision, our bond becomes something the academy has never seen: a closed circuit powerful enough to let me project the Interface, seize command of the environment, and fight as a ghost in the machine—opening trapdoors, rerouting pressure, and turning the academy itself into my weapon.
But every fix comes with a cost.
Because the “Rot” isn’t just poison. It’s a signal—and something in the sky is listening.
